Tania Nathan : Daughter of Immigrants

Daughter of Immigrants explores themes of longing, belonging, and identity through poetry and short stories in a postcolonial context.
Daughter of Immigrants is a book of poetry and short stories about longing and belonging, home and roots. It is a love letter for brown people everywhere, for them to take courage and find their voice. In a post colonial world, it is a book about the sons and daughters that dare to dream the dreams their parents and grandparents gave them.
Tania Nathan is a writer and poet from a land of monsoons and rain birds who dreams of hot and sweet things from home. She lives and works in Helsinki, Finland.
